Transactions in local currencies between African countries: PAPSS now operational

Depuis le lundi dernier, le Pan-African Payment and Settlement System (PAPSS) is operational for UBA Guinea. This is a flagship initiative of AfreximBank Banque africaine d' import-export () in collaboration with

the African Union.

PAPSS aims to revolutionize cross-border payments in Africa, facilitating commercial exchanges by allowing transactions in local currencies between African countries. It represents a major advance for trade and economic integration on the continent. By reducing dependence on hard currencies such as the euro and the dollar, the system promises to decrease transaction costs and speed up the settlement process. Through PAPSS, UBA Guinea is paving the way for its customers to take full advantage of this system. Bank customers can make and receive payments in local currency for cross-border transactions with other African countries participating in the system

.

As a reminder, PAPSS is actively used by several African countries, including Guinea, Ghana, Nigeria, Sierra Leone, Sierra Leone, Gambia, and Liberia, promoting closer integration and increased efficiency in their cross-border trade transactions. Likewise, the system is preparing to welcome new members in the near future, with the expected accession of Djibouti, Zimbabwe, Zambia, Kenya and Rwanda

.
